From aef7a095c8d9ceba4d2595bf41902369272551a3 Mon Sep 17 00:00:00 2001 From: Damien Miller Date: Tue, 22 Jan 2002 23:07:52 +1100 Subject: - markus@cvs.openbsd.org 2001/12/25 18:53:00 [auth1.c] be more carefull on allocation --- ChangeLog | 5 ++++- auth1.c | 4 +++- 2 files changed, 7 insertions(+), 2 deletions(-) diff --git a/ChangeLog b/ChangeLog index beccb5297..a75883387 100644 --- a/ChangeLog +++ b/ChangeLog @@ -29,6 +29,9 @@ - markus@cvs.openbsd.org 2001/12/25 18:49:56 [key.c] be more careful on allocation + - markus@cvs.openbsd.org 2001/12/25 18:53:00 + [auth1.c] + be more carefull on allocation 20020121 - (djm) Rework ssh-rand-helper: @@ -7176,4 +7179,4 @@ - Wrote replacements for strlcpy and mkdtemp - Released 1.0pre1 -$Id: ChangeLog,v 1.1730 2002/01/22 12:07:21 djm Exp $ +$Id: ChangeLog,v 1.1731 2002/01/22 12:07:52 djm Exp $ diff --git a/auth1.c b/auth1.c index 3aac26fcc..41628cedc 100644 --- a/auth1.c +++ b/auth1.c @@ -10,7 +10,7 @@ */ #include "includes.h" -RCSID("$OpenBSD: auth1.c,v 1.27 2001/12/19 07:18:56 deraadt Exp $"); +RCSID("$OpenBSD: auth1.c,v 1.28 2001/12/25 18:53:00 markus Exp $"); #include "xmalloc.h" #include "rsa.h" @@ -231,6 +231,8 @@ do_authloop(Authctxt *authctxt) } /* RSA authentication requested. */ n = BN_new(); + if (n == NULL) + fatal("BN_new failed"); packet_get_bignum(n, &nlen); packet_integrity_check(plen, nlen, type); authenticated = auth_rsa(pw, n); -- cgit v1.2.3